ADDRESSES: FOR FURTHER INFORMATION CONTACT: SUPPLEMENTARY INFORMATION: REGULATORY TEXT: 80-07-10 COSTRUZIONI AERONAUTICHE GIOVANNI AGUSTA: Amendment 39- 3714. Applies to A109A helicopters, certificated in all categories. Compliance is required within the next 100 hours time in service after the effective date of this AD, unless already accomplished. To prevent ambiguous or incorrect indication of engine operating condition, accomplish the following: (a) For those helicopters that have engine failure indicator, P/N 109-0729-22-3, installed, replace the engine failure indicator, P/N 109-0729-22-3, with a new indicator, P/N 109- 0729-22-5, and incorporate temporary pages in the Rotorcraft Flight Manual, in accordance with Agusta Bollettino Tecnico No. 109-9, dated February 23, 1978 or an equivalent approved by the Chief, Aircraft Certification Staff, AEU-100, FAA, Europe, Africa, and Middle East Region. (b) For those helicopters that have engine failure indicator, P/N 109-0729-22-5, installed, unless already accomplished, incorporate temporary pages in the Rotorcraft Flight Manual, in accordance with Agusta Bollettino Tecnico No. 109-9, dated February 23, 1978 or an equivalent approved by the Chief, Aircraft Certification Staff, FAA, Europe, Africa, and Middle East Region. (c) If a Rotorcraft Flight Manual includes permanent pages which incorporate the material on temporary pages 3-5 required by paragraphs (a) and (b) of this AD, the temporary pages need not be incorporated. This amendment becomes effective March 27, 1980. FOOTER:
